Partager via


FileShares interface

Interface représentant un FileShares.

Méthodes

create(string, string, string, FileShare, FileSharesCreateOptionalParams)

Crée un nouveau partage sous le compte spécifié, comme décrit par le corps de la demande. La ressource de partage inclut des métadonnées et propriétés pour ce partage. Elle ne comprend pas la liste des fichiers contenus dans le partage.

delete(string, string, string, FileSharesDeleteOptionalParams)

Supprime le partage spécifié sous son compte.

get(string, string, string, FileSharesGetOptionalParams)

Obtient les propriétés d’un partage spécifié.

lease(string, string, string, FileSharesLeaseOptionalParams)

L’opération Lease Share établit et gère un verrou sur un partage pour les opérations de suppression. La durée du verrou peut être de 15 à 60 secondes, ou peut être infinie.

list(string, string, FileSharesListOptionalParams)

Répertorie tous les partages.

restore(string, string, string, DeletedShare, FileSharesRestoreOptionalParams)

Restaurer un partage de fichiers dans un délai de conservation valide si la suppression réversible de partage est activée

update(string, string, string, FileShare, FileSharesUpdateOptionalParams)

Mises à jour les propriétés de partage comme spécifié dans le corps de la requête. Les propriétés non mentionnées dans la demande ne seront pas modifiées. La mise à jour échoue si le partage spécifié n’existe pas déjà.

Détails de la méthode

create(string, string, string, FileShare, FileSharesCreateOptionalParams)

Crée un nouveau partage sous le compte spécifié, comme décrit par le corps de la demande. La ressource de partage inclut des métadonnées et propriétés pour ce partage. Elle ne comprend pas la liste des fichiers contenus dans le partage.

function create(resourceGroupName: string, accountName: string, shareName: string, fileShare: FileShare, options?: FileSharesCreateOptionalParams): Promise<FileShare>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

shareName

string

Nom du partage de fichiers dans le compte de stockage spécifié. Les noms de partages de fichiers doivent comporter entre 3 et 63 caractères et utiliser des nombres, des minuscules et des tirets (-) uniquement. Chaque tiret (-) doit être immédiatement précédé et suivi d'une lettre ou d'un chiffre.

fileShare
FileShare

Propriétés du partage de fichiers à créer.

options
FileSharesCreateOptionalParams

Paramètres d’options.

Retours

Promise<FileShare>

delete(string, string, string, FileSharesDeleteOptionalParams)

Supprime le partage spécifié sous son compte.

function delete(resourceGroupName: string, accountName: string, shareName: string, options?: FileSharesDeleteOptionalParams): Promise<void>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

shareName

string

Nom du partage de fichiers dans le compte de stockage spécifié. Les noms de partages de fichiers doivent comporter entre 3 et 63 caractères et utiliser des nombres, des minuscules et des tirets (-) uniquement. Chaque tiret (-) doit être immédiatement précédé et suivi d'une lettre ou d'un chiffre.

options
FileSharesDeleteOptionalParams

Paramètres d’options.

Retours

Promise<void>

get(string, string, string, FileSharesGetOptionalParams)

Obtient les propriétés d’un partage spécifié.

function get(resourceGroupName: string, accountName: string, shareName: string, options?: FileSharesGetOptionalParams): Promise<FileShare>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

shareName

string

Nom du partage de fichiers dans le compte de stockage spécifié. Les noms de partages de fichiers doivent comporter entre 3 et 63 caractères et utiliser des nombres, des minuscules et des tirets (-) uniquement. Chaque tiret (-) doit être immédiatement précédé et suivi d'une lettre ou d'un chiffre.

options
FileSharesGetOptionalParams

Paramètres d’options.

Retours

Promise<FileShare>

lease(string, string, string, FileSharesLeaseOptionalParams)

L’opération Lease Share établit et gère un verrou sur un partage pour les opérations de suppression. La durée du verrou peut être de 15 à 60 secondes, ou peut être infinie.

function lease(resourceGroupName: string, accountName: string, shareName: string, options?: FileSharesLeaseOptionalParams): Promise<FileSharesLeaseResponse>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

shareName

string

Nom du partage de fichiers dans le compte de stockage spécifié. Les noms de partages de fichiers doivent comporter entre 3 et 63 caractères et utiliser des nombres, des minuscules et des tirets (-) uniquement. Chaque tiret (-) doit être immédiatement précédé et suivi d'une lettre ou d'un chiffre.

options
FileSharesLeaseOptionalParams

Paramètres d’options.

Retours

list(string, string, FileSharesListOptionalParams)

Répertorie tous les partages.

function list(resourceGroupName: string, accountName: string, options?: FileSharesListOptionalParams): PagedAsyncIterableIterator<FileShareItem, FileShareItem[], PageSettings>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

options
FileSharesListOptionalParams

Paramètres d’options.

Retours

restore(string, string, string, DeletedShare, FileSharesRestoreOptionalParams)

Restaurer un partage de fichiers dans un délai de conservation valide si la suppression réversible de partage est activée

function restore(resourceGroupName: string, accountName: string, shareName: string, deletedShare: DeletedShare, options?: FileSharesRestoreOptionalParams): Promise<void>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

shareName

string

Nom du partage de fichiers dans le compte de stockage spécifié. Les noms de partages de fichiers doivent comporter entre 3 et 63 caractères et utiliser des nombres, des minuscules et des tirets (-) uniquement. Chaque tiret (-) doit être immédiatement précédé et suivi d'une lettre ou d'un chiffre.

deletedShare
DeletedShare

Partage supprimé à restaurer.

options
FileSharesRestoreOptionalParams

Paramètres d’options.

Retours

Promise<void>

update(string, string, string, FileShare, FileSharesUpdateOptionalParams)

Mises à jour les propriétés de partage comme spécifié dans le corps de la requête. Les propriétés non mentionnées dans la demande ne seront pas modifiées. La mise à jour échoue si le partage spécifié n’existe pas déjà.

function update(resourceGroupName: string, accountName: string, shareName: string, fileShare: FileShare, options?: FileSharesUpdateOptionalParams): Promise<FileShare>

Paramètres

resourceGroupName

string

Nom du groupe de ressources dans l’abonnement de l’utilisateur. Le nom ne respecte pas la casse.

accountName

string

Nom du compte de stockage au sein du groupe de ressources spécifié. Ce nom doit comprendre entre 3 et 24 caractères, uniquement des lettres en minuscules et des nombres.

shareName

string

Nom du partage de fichiers dans le compte de stockage spécifié. Les noms de partages de fichiers doivent comporter entre 3 et 63 caractères et utiliser des nombres, des minuscules et des tirets (-) uniquement. Chaque tiret (-) doit être immédiatement précédé et suivi d'une lettre ou d'un chiffre.

fileShare
FileShare

Propriétés à mettre à jour pour le partage de fichiers.

options
FileSharesUpdateOptionalParams

Paramètres d’options.

Retours

Promise<FileShare>